.aboutpage_aboutWrapper__eAcl9{margin:calc(100vh/4) 0;padding:0 2.5%;& section{width:clamp(24rem,100%,64rem);margin:auto;& h2{text-align:center;font-size:2.4rem;margin-bottom:8rem;&:first-letter{font-size:4.8rem}}& dl{& div{font-size:1.4rem;border-left:1px solid #bfbfbf;border-bottom:1px solid #bfbfbf;&:not(:last-of-type){margin-bottom:4rem}& dt{background-color:#4e4e4e;color:#fff;text-align:center;width:-moz-fit-content;width:fit-content;padding:.25em 2.5em}& dd{padding:2em 1.5em;& ul{list-style:none;& li{&.aboutpage_basebusiness__ek4Sc{font-weight:700;letter-spacing:.05em;font-size:1.8rem;&:not(:last-of-type){margin-bottom:2rem}& p{font-weight:400;letter-spacing:0;font-size:1.4rem;border-top:1px solid #bfbfbf;padding-top:1em}}}}}}}}}@media screen and (min-width:1025px){.aboutpage_aboutWrapper__eAcl9{padding:0 2.5em;& section{width:clamp(640px,100%,560px);& h2{font-size:24px;margin-bottom:80px;&:first-letter{font-size:48px}}& dl{& div{font-size:14px;&:not(:last-of-type){margin-bottom:40px}& dd{& ul{& li{&.aboutpage_basebusiness__ek4Sc{font-size:18px;&:not(:last-of-type){margin-bottom:20px}& p{font-size:14px}}}}}}}}}}